Re: Where to put the radio?? 1959 TF.

How about an overhead console?

I had a friend with a 55 210 coupe. He build an overhead console (running right to left along the windshield) that gave him a place for a stereo and other things that was actually pretty non-obtrusive and helped him keep his dash completely stock.
